Will Alsop Goes Bonkers in Yonkers


From Treehugger by Lloyd Alter:
Will Aslop is converting an old power plant on the Hudson River into a museum and restaurant with a 400 unit residential tower on top. Alsop says: “I’m really excited. Not only is this my first building in the US but I have the opportunity to build on a river, adjacent to a world-class city with a client that is enthusiastic about creating a carbon-free building.” Engineer Guy Battle ensures that "In addition to producing its own energy, the building will also have a rainwater-collection system, and the ecology surrounding the site will be restored to its natural state."
